5.0 out of 5 stars Fun with calculators and the TI-30, June 1, 2009
By Donald Gillies "secretbearer" (San Diego, CA United States) - See all my reviews
(REAL NAME)   
This paperback book, 224 pages, was a freebie included with TI-30 calculators purchased in the 1970's. Many people consider the book, which covers algebra, business and finance, trigonometry, probability and statistics, physics and chemistry, and includes puzzles, games and more, to be as valuable as the TI-30 calculator, itself one of the best-selling calculators of the 1970's era (the TI-30 probably had half the scientific calculator market in the late 1970's.) I haven't looked at my copy of the book in many years but I had a blast when I got it my sophomore year in high school; I think it's time to open it up and show it to my kids so that we can enjoy it again.
